Roger S Pressman Software Engineering 6th Edition Ppt |work| -

Software Engineering: A Comprehensive Approach with Roger S. Pressman's 6th Edition PPT

Software engineering is a rapidly evolving field that has become an essential part of modern technology. As software systems become increasingly complex, the need for a structured approach to software development has never been more pressing. One of the most widely used and respected textbooks in the field is Roger S. Pressman's "Software Engineering: A Practitioner's Approach," now in its 6th edition. In this article, we will explore the key concepts and features of the 6th edition of Pressman's book, as well as provide an overview of the accompanying PowerPoint presentation (PPT).

About Roger S. Pressman's "Software Engineering: A Practitioner's Approach"

Roger S. Pressman's "Software Engineering: A Practitioner's Approach" has been a leading textbook in the field of software engineering for over two decades. The book provides a comprehensive and practical guide to software engineering, covering the principles, methods, and tools used in the development of software systems. The 6th edition of the book continues this tradition, providing updated coverage of the latest developments in software engineering.

Key Features of the 6th Edition

The 6th edition of Pressman's book includes several key features that make it an essential resource for students and practitioners alike. Some of the key features include:

The Accompanying PowerPoint Presentation (PPT)

The 6th edition of Pressman's book is accompanied by a comprehensive PowerPoint presentation (PPT) that provides a visual guide to the key concepts and principles of software engineering. The PPT includes:

Benefits of Using the 6th Edition PPT

The 6th edition PPT provides several benefits for students and instructors, including:

Using the 6th Edition PPT in the Classroom roger s pressman software engineering 6th edition ppt

The 6th edition PPT can be used in a variety of ways in the classroom, including:

Conclusion

Roger S. Pressman's "Software Engineering: A Practitioner's Approach" (6th edition) is a comprehensive and practical guide to software engineering. The accompanying PowerPoint presentation (PPT) provides a valuable resource for students and instructors, helping to explain complex concepts and principles in a clear and engaging way. Whether you are a student or an instructor, the 6th edition of Pressman's book and the accompanying PPT are essential resources for anyone interested in software engineering.

Download the 6th Edition PPT

If you are interested in downloading the 6th edition PPT, you can do so from a variety of online sources, including:

Tips for Using the 6th Edition PPT

Here are some tips for using the 6th edition PPT:

By following these tips and using the 6th edition PPT in conjunction with the textbook and other learning materials, you can gain a deeper understanding of software engineering principles and concepts, and develop the skills and knowledge needed to succeed in this rapidly evolving field.

The 6th edition of Roger S. Pressman's Software Engineering: A Practitioner's Approach

is a landmark textbook that bridges theoretical principles with practical application. It is structured into 32 chapters across five major parts, notably introducing a dedicated section on Web Engineering. Core Content Structure Software Engineering: A Comprehensive Approach with Roger S

An effective guide or presentation based on this edition typically follows these five key parts:

The Software Process: Covers generic process views, prescriptive process models (like Waterfall and RAD), and the then-emerging Agile Development.

Software Engineering Practice: Focuses on core technical activities including Requirements Engineering, Analysis Modeling, and various levels of design (Architectural, Component, and User Interface).

Applying Web Engineering: A new addition to the 6th edition, detailing the formulation, planning, modeling, and testing specifically for Web Applications.

Managing Software Projects: Explores project management concepts, metrics, estimation, scheduling, risk management, and quality control.

Advanced Topics: Discusses formal methods, Cleanroom software engineering, component-based development, and reengineering. Key Concepts for Presentations

When building slides, these foundational Pressman themes are essential: SOFTWARE ENGINEERING

FAQ: Roger S Pressman Software Engineering 6th Edition PPT

Q: Are there PPTs for the "Metrics" chapter (Chapter 4 in 6th ed)? Yes. Chapter 4 (Software Project Planning) contains the famous LOC and FP slides. Look for a slide titled "Size-Oriented Metrics" – it usually has a table showing a comparison of a past project's LOC, effort, cost, and defects per KLOC (thousand lines of code).

Q: Can I edit the PPTs if I download them? If you get the official McGraw-Hill PPTs, they are usually standard .pptx files. You can edit them freely. If you download a PDF conversion from SlideShare, you cannot edit it. Use the official version to add your own instructor notes.

Q: Do the 6th edition PPTs include the "Software Engineering Code of Ethics"? Yes. That is located in the slides for Chapter 1 or the Appendix. Pressman was a pioneer in emphasizing professional ethics. The PPT includes the eight principles (Public, Client, Product, Judgment, Management, Profession, Colleagues, Self). Updated coverage of agile development methodologies : The

Comparison: 6th Edition PPTs vs. Newer Editions (7th, 8th, 9th)

Why not just use the 8th edition slides? Here is the critical difference:

| Feature | Pressman 6th Edition PPT | Pressman 8th/9th Edition PPT | | :--- | :--- | :--- | | Focus | Foundational, heavy on CMMI and classic process models | Heavy on Agile, DevOps, Cloud computing, and Security | | Page Count | ~20-30 slides per chapter (condensed) | ~40-50 slides per chapter (expansive) | | UML Version | UML 1.x (basic class/sequence diagrams) | UML 2.x (interaction overview, timing diagrams) | | Test Bank Style | Fact-based (definition of LOC, FP) | Scenario-based (a startup wants X, what model do you use?) |

Verdict: If your course is focused on fundamentals (waterfall, spiral, basic black/white box testing), the 6th edition PPTs are superior because they are less cluttered. If your course is modern Agile/DevOps, you need the 9th edition.

Part 3: Quality Assurance and Testing (Chapters 13-17)

Pressman is legendary for his testing taxonomy. The PPTs here typically include:

A. The "Adaptable" Approach

Pressman’s slides are famous for being instructor-friendly. Unlike many textbook slides which are dense walls of text, these slides are often designed as "talking points." This allows lecturers to expand on concepts verbally rather than reading directly from the screen, fostering better classroom engagement.

What is Included in the "Roger S Pressman Software Engineering 6th Edition PPT" Decks?

The official instructor resources for Pressman’s 6th edition typically include a series of PowerPoint files organized by chapter. If you acquire a legitimate copy (usually via McGraw-Hill’s instructor repository), you will find approximately 25 to 30 separate PPT files.

Here is a breakdown of the key modules you can expect to find in these presentation decks:

Relevance Today

While aspects of the 6th edition are dated—particularly in tooling and process trends—the core principles it teaches (requirements clarity, design quality, testing rigor, metrics, and project management fundamentals) remain highly relevant. For modern teams, the book pairs well with contemporary readings on Agile, DevOps, microservices, and automated testing to provide a robust foundation.

Part 2: Software Project Management

Ch 4: Project Management Concepts

Ch 5: Software Metrics and Estimation

Ch 6: Project Scheduling & Tracking